    Virtual MIDI Piano Keyboard

    Virtual MIDI Piano Keyboard

    Virtual MIDI controller for Linux, Windows and OSX

    VMPK is a virtual MIDI piano keyboard for Linux, Windows and OSX. Based on Qt and Drumstick the program is a MIDI event generator using the computer's alphanumeric keyboard and the mouse. It may be used also to display received MIDI notes.

    KeymouseGo

    KeymouseGo

    Automate mouse clicks and keyboard input

    KeymouseGo is a lightweight, open-source Windows/Mac/Linux automation tool built with Python. It records and replays mouse and keyboard actions—for example, click sequences and typing—allowing repetition of repetitive tasks via scripts or GUI buttons.

    PDF Arranger

    PDF Arranger

    Small python-gtk application, to merge or split PDFs

    PDF Arranger is a small python-gtk application, which helps the user to merge or split PDF documents and rotate, crop and rearrange their pages using an interactive and intuitive graphical interface. It is a front end for pikepdf. PDF Arranger is a fork of Konstantinos Poulios’s PDF Shuffler (see Savannah or Sourceforge). It’s a humble attempt to make the project a bit more active.

    PixelGrip Virtual controller

    PixelGrip Virtual controller

    Program to control vJoy and vXbox devices using keyboard, mouse, or jo

    This program enables control of vJoy and vXbox virtual devices using keyboard, mouse, or joystick inputs. It allows flexible button mapping, axis configuration, and customization of virtual controllers to simulate various physical game controllers. The software supports up to 8 axes, 128 buttons, and 4 POV hat switches, ensuring wide compatibility with different gaming setups. It is designed for gamers and developers to enhance game control experiences and test inputs across multiple devices with ease. ...

    OSX-KVM

    OSX-KVM

    Run macOS on QEMU/KVM

    OSX-KVM is a collection of scripts, firmware files, and documentation for running macOS virtual machines on Linux with QEMU and KVM. It uses OpenCore and OVMF components to create a Virtual Hackintosh without requiring a Mac host. The project can fetch installers for multiple macOS generations, prepare installation media, and guide users through the complete virtual machine setup.     BikeControl

    BikeControl

    Do virtual gear shifting (and more) in any rider app

    ...Instead of connecting to the trainer directly, BikeControl acts as a bridge: when you press a button or lever on your controller, it intercepts the input and simulates corresponding keyboard/mouse/touch events for your trainer application. This allows you to perform actions like virtual gear shifting, steering, changing workout intensity, controlling music, etc., even if the trainer app doesn’t natively support those controllers. It works on different platforms: on Android, it uses the AccessibilityService API to send simulated touches to whatever app window is active; on desktop (Windows/macOS), it can emulate key/mouse input via configurable keymaps so users can tailor controls.

    pywinauto

    pywinauto

    Windows GUI Automation with Python (based on text properties)

    pywinauto is a set of Python modules to automate the Microsoft Windows GUI. At its simplest it allows you to send mouse and keyboard actions to Windows dialogs and controls, but it has support for more complex actions like getting text data.
